Intrexx

Intrexx is a cross-platform integrated development environment for the creation and operation of multilingual web-based applications, intranets, social intranets, enterprise portals and customer portals (extranets) as well as Industry 4.0 solutions as of 2018. A portal is created based on the drag and drop principle, keeping the need for programming skills to a minimum. Furthermore, Intrexx can create mobile applications for iPhone, BlackBerry, Android and the like with just a few mouse clicks.

Intrexx
Developer(s)United Planet GmbH
Initial release1999 (1999)
Stable release
9.3 (19.09)[1] / September 19, 2019 (2019-09-19)
Written inJava, Apache Velocity, JavaScript, TypeScript, Groovy
Operating systemUnix-like system, Microsoft Windows, Mac OS[2]
TypeIntranet portal, Web framework
Websitewww.intrexx.com

History

The first version of the software was released by the German software vendor, United Planet, under the name "Intrazone" in 1999. In 2000, the software was renamed to "Intrexx Xtreme". With the release of Intrexx 5.0 in March 2010, the product line was divided into two editions: Intrexx Professional and Intrexx Compact. Intrexx Professional is the continuation of the Xtreme series and is still intended for SMEs and public administrations. Intrexx Compact contains a complete company portal with more than 50 ready-made web-applications and templates and is tailor-made for smaller companies with up to 10 PC workstations. According to the manufacturer, there have been implemented more than 5,000 Intrexx portals by now (cited date: 2019).[3] Between 2012–2014, the US IT research and advisory company Gartner Inc. placed United Planet with Intrexx in its renowned market overview "Magic Quadrant for Horizontal Portals".[4] Since then, the product has received multiple awards such as "Social Business Leader" five times (ISG Provider Lens; including 2018) "Digital Workspace Leader" (ISG Provider Lens; 2017) and PC Magazin "SEHR GUT" (01/2019).

Today, Intrexx is a low-code development platform for complete digital workplace solutions and total digitalization of companies.

Milestones:

  • Intrexx 2.0 (2004): Enhanced tools to integrate existing data from third-party systems
  • Intrexx 3.0 (2006): Integration of a so-called "Process Manager", allowing companies to model business processes graphically, connect these together and automate them
  • Intrexx 4.0 (2007): Option to consume and provide web services
  • Intrexx 4.5 (2008): Integration of the dynamic programming language "Groovy"
  • Intrexx 5.0 (2010):
    • Intrexx is the first software solution that can convert web-based applications during their creation so that they can be accessed from mobile devices
    • Improved accessibility according to the W3C standards
  • Intrexx 6.0 (2012):
    • With the new module "Relationship Designer", data from all existing software systems within the company can be connected, irrespective of their manufacturer (until Intrexx Version 18.09)
    • Business Adapters for SAP NetWeaver Gateway and all OData data sources
    • Technological basis for the new social business software, Intrexx Share
  • Intrexx Share (2013):
    • Intrexx Share expands Intrexx with a new type of social business solution that harnesses the communication technologies, which are known from social networks (Facebook, Twitter etc.), for use in enterprises
    • Intrexx Share stands out from the other social business solutions because not only are a company's employees included in the knowledge exchange, but also the software solutions (e.g. Intranet, CRM, ERP, BI, Exchange etc.).
    • If somebody writes or edits data in Intrexx Share's user interface, this is written to the corresponding specialized application in realtime. This means that employees are able to react to news feeds, which are created by the specialized applications, directly from Intrexx Share.
    • Exchanging data and documents is more secure with Intrexx Share than with many other social business solutions which often come from the USA. This is because the data is stored on the protected company server and not in the cloud.
  • Intrexx 7.0 (2014):
    • Further improvements to Intrexx's ability to integrate thanks to the OData Adapter and M-Files Adapter.
    • The Intrexx Formula Editor enables users to create computational calculations for the first time in the Portal Manager.
    • Introduction of the new Calendar and Resource controls.
    • User-friendlier file handling with multiple file uploads.
  • Intrexx 8.0 (2016):
    • It is now possible to create pages and applications with responsive design
    • Instead of the previously used Apache Lucene, Apache Solr is implemented as a search engine in the context of the portal process
    • The search function has been expanded with new filtering options and the ability to search in multiple languages
    • Language constants and a translation aid simplify the creation of multilingual portals and applications
    • Designing applications in the Applications Designer is made easier thanks to templates and helplines – meaning that applications can be created faster than ever before
  • Intrexx 18.03 (2018):[5]
    • New version name
    • Connector for Microsoft Office 365; Possible to open and save Office 365 documents directly from Intrexx
    • Intrexx Mobile App: Any number of portals can be added, access to key information - including push notifications
    • Intrexx Share 2.2: Social collaboration tools with chat, groups, filebox (file storage system) and news feed
  • Intrexx 18.09 (2018):[6]
    • Connector API: Ready-made connectors for leading software systems such as SAP, Microsoft, IBM and many other systems
    • Intrexx Industrial: Complete Industry 4.0 solution including automated logbook, OEE analysis and much more
  • Intrexx 19.03 (2019):[7]
    • New business logic: New logic for reading, writing, validating and filtering data
    • Java 11:Both the Portal Manager and Server are now based on Java Runtime version 11. Users can choose to use existing Java licenses or switch to the open source option OpenJDK.
    • REST API: Communication between the Portal Manager and other servers has been switched to the REST API
    • Multi-tenancy capability: Security when developing portals with multiple tenants/branches/locations
    • Horizontal scaling: Intrexx 19.03 is elastically horizontally scalable on almost all cloud platforms such as Amazon - AWS, Azure and Open Telekom Cloud
    • Versioning: Semantic versioning and versioning with GIT for improved, individual application development
    • Portlet framework: The completely new and responsive portlet framework provides users with more options and greater flexibility when developing applications and designing pages
  • Intrexx 19.09 (2019):[8]
    • Portal Manager as a live version: Start the Intrexx Portal Manager with ease from any directory - even without administrator permissions
    • TinyMCE Editor: The new TinyMCE Editor increases usability when it comes to editing texts in Intrexx applications
    • Internationalization: Country-dependent languages and currency formats for an internationally operating company
    • High security: Corresponding script methods now verify whether the applicable password guidelines have been adhered to when a password is entered
    • Support of 'diverse' as a gender: The user manager now allows you to select 'diverse' as a third gender option
    • Intrexx cluster support included in setup: From version 19.09 onwards, Intrexx allows you to add the portal server as an instance of an Intrexx cluster
    • Responsive view image control: With a new option for the view image control, images and photos are scaled according to the current layout and are therefore always displayed at a suitable size for the end device
  • Intrexx 20.03 (2020):[9]
    • Subselects/Subqueries in filters: Very straightforward to define a subquery for a filter expression.
    • Global workflow user: Better rights management for users.
    • Improved style options: Significantly improved styles and usability.
    • Filter multiple selection elements via dependencies: Multiple selection elements can be filtered directly via dependencies.
    • Bindings in filters: Different bindings in the filter dialog.
    • New Gallery: The new gallery is responsive, looks more modern than its predecessors and can play videos.
    • WebSockets: Developers can send messages directly from the server to the browser (push).

Architecture

Intrexx basically consists of two parts:

Intrexx Portal Manager

It is installed on any client or on the server and possesses all the components for developing and managing layout, menu or applications.Furthermore, users can be configured and provided with permissions for the respective portal applications in the Portal Manager.

Intrexx Portal Server

It is installed on a server and controls all transactions of the created web-based applications and portals. It monitors the permissions of the users within the transactions, controls the entire business logic operations and governs access to the data sources.

Functions

Intrexx provides companies with the ability to create and manage multilingual web-based applications, intranets, social intranets, enterprise portals and customer portals (extranets) as well as Industry 4.0 solutions as of 2018. In doing so, the software sees itself as an alternative to Microsoft SharePoint.[10] Design and usability of the portal are provided by the integrated portal designer based on CSS and XML, enabling the adoption to the corporate identity of the company via XSL-transformations. Single sign-on guarantees a secure authentication and role-based authorization. The synchronization with existing LDAP-servers is possible.

Intrexx is based 100% on Java and contains the following modules:

Designer

The Designer allows enterprises to create their portal layout according to their individual corporate identity: colors, fonts, symbols, buttons and menu structures can be selected via mouse click from lists as well as a multitude of already premade design templates.

Applications

With the Application Designer, applications and forms can be created without programming knowledge - via drag and drop. With the help of a wizard, users select the desired edit and output controls, as well as the required buttons, and create applications - for the desktop PC, laptop, and smartphone.

Processes

Thanks to the graphical interface of the Process Designer, processes can be transferred into electronic workflows and automated by Drag-and-drop. The user can also define conditions and actions.

Relations

The graphic Relationship Designer can link up the data from all existing software systems within a company, irrespective of their manufacturer. Once a specific piece of information is invoked, the Intrexx Relationship Designer automatically searches the linked systems for thematically connected information and displays it for the employees on the intranet in a concentrated manner.

Users

In the User Manager, administrators can define who may access which applications and functions in the portal. It is possible to make the access permissions dependent on the function of the employee or combine specific employees into one permissions group.

Integration

With Intrexx, users have direct read and write access to almost any database in an enterprise, as well as import or export its data. In the same way, ERP systems like SAP ERP can be connected with read and/or write scenarios.

Tools

Intrexx contains different tools that support the administrator in his/her work. A System Monitor, for example, shows the current system load, the activities in the enterprise portal, the status of memory use, and the connections to the database as well. The Task Planner delivers an overview of all running processes.

Interfaces

Special Business Integration Adapters (Connectors) enable the integration of data from third-party systems such as SAP (SAP Business Suite, SAP Business One, SAP Gateway), JDBC data sources as well all OData data sources. A special Connector for Microsoft Office (Word, Excel etc.) also allows the organization of Microsoft Office Documents within the enterprise portal. The interface with Microsoft SharePoint and Microsoft Exchange enables companies to integrate data from Microsoft SharePoint lists and document libraries into Intrexx applications and processes, and also access calendars, contacts, tasks and emails from Outlook.

The Connectors for ABACUS business software, M-Files, dg hyparchive and IBM Lotus Notes enables users to save and archive data from the respective system and integrate it into Intrexx processes and applications.

Ready-made solutions

Ready-made portals

Ready-made portals have been created for specific industries and business areas. These include a clinic portal, school portal, quality management portal, a portal for child daycare centers and an Industry 4.0 solution.

Ready-made applications

Similar to Apple the vendor United Planet offers ready-made business applications, forms, processes and layout templates in the so-called Intrexx Application Store.[11]

Award

    • Testsieger im Intranet-Vergleichstest (Internet Professional, 2000)
    • Newcomer des Jahres (Computer Reseller News, 2001)
    • Produkt des Jahres (PC-Magazin, 2000/2001, 2001/2002, 2002/2003)
    • Innovationspreis der Stadt Freiburg (Stadt Freiburg, 2004)
    • Innovationspreis des Landes Baden-Württemberg (Wirtschaftsministerium Baden-Württemberg, Anerkennung 2005)
    • Innovationspreis in der Kategorie SOA (Initiative Mittelstand, 2008)
    • Nominierung für den JAX Innovationsaward (2008)
    • JDK.de Innovationsaward (Jdk.de, 2009)
    • Juryliste "Großer Preis des Mittelstandes" (2009, 2011)
    • Digital Workplace Leader (ISG Provider Lens, 2017)
    • 5maliger Business Leader (ISG Provider Lens, u. a. 2018)
    • PC Magazin "SEHR GUT" (PC Magazin, 01/2019)
    • Business & IT "SEHR GUT" (Business & IT, 01/2019)

References

  1. Intrexx 19.09 release notes - https://www.intrexx.com/en/intrexx-release-note-1909
  2. System requirements - https://www.intrexx.com/en/system-1903
  3. "United Planet". United Planet. Retrieved 2019-10-25.
  4. "Gartner's Magic Quadrant For Horizontal Portals: Oracle, IBM, Microsoft, SAP, Liferay Top Dogs". CMS Wire. Retrieved 2012-10-26.
  5. "Intrexx release notes - Version 18.03". Intrexx release notes - Version 18.03. Retrieved 2019-10-25.
  6. "Intrexx release notes - Version 18.09". Intrexx release notes - Version 18.09. Retrieved 2019-10-25.
  7. "Intrexx Release Note - Version 19.03". Intrexx Release Note - Version 19.03. Retrieved 2019-10-25.
  8. "Intrexx Release Notes - Version 19.09". Intrexx Release Notes - Version 19.09. Retrieved 2019-10-25.
  9. "Intrexx 20.03 release notes". Intrexx 20.03 release notes. Retrieved 2020-04-15.
  10. "Intrexx offers real alternative to IBM, SAP and Microsoft portal platforms". United Planet. Retrieved 2009-07-08.
  11. Intrexx Application Store
This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.